Transaction 3ab86a9a866a5e82da5d96f7c80de58ba14ec61fa2e5f01c41b14946e81b5e8f
1 Input
1 Output
-
3ab86a9a866a5e82da5d96f7c80de58ba14ec61fa2e5f01c41b14946e81b5e8f:0
- value
- 2687450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 063b2e6428c79f1a1824515968e3ded2e176d126 OP_EQUAL
- address
- 32FxsgG2oVc1UBEy5EKFEjvj5Ew1dZiotT